Open to the community

Woman lifting a weight
Sports and exercise

Fitness classes, campus gyms and free campus walks.

A man standing in an office
Free legal advice

Get specialist advice from our award-winning law clinics.

An office worker facing the camera, with blurred colleagues in the background
Temporary work

Register with our recruitment agency, ARU Temps. We are proud to be Living Wage accredited.

A male student helps another male get into position for performance testing
Sport and Exercise Therapy Clinic

Low-cost injury assessments, rehabilitation and sports massage.

Person with head in a machine having an eye test
Cambridge Eye Clinic

Free eye tests and specialist facilities in contact lenses, low vision and visual stress.

A smiling baby being cuddled
Breastfeeding Support Hub

Free face-to-face lactation information, support and education on our Cambridge, Chelmsford and Peterborough campuses.

Two music therapists leading a group music therapy session for older people and their carers in a hall
Together in Sound

Free ten-week music therapy groups for people living with dementia and their caregivers in Saffron Walden.

Canine therapy student assessing a dog
Pet and canine services

Specialist pet behaviour and canine services, including canine rehabilitation, dog grooming and pet behaviour on our Writtle campus.

Cambridge School of Creative Industries performing a musical on stage
Arts and culture

Unique exhibitions at the Ruskin Gallery and professional performances at the Mumford Theatre in Cambridge.

Our community initiatives

Hands encircling four small figures
Community organising

We empower people by supporting refugees, voter registration, community participation, and more.

Six keynote presenters posing with information booklets at the PPIE launch in Chelmsford
Let's Shape Research Together

Our Let's Shape Research Together programme enables members of the public to collaborate with academics at the early stages of research design.

Five students huddled around a laptop
Students at the Heart of Knowledge Exchange (SHoKE)

We connect partner organisations with experienced, engaged and enthusiastic students who can bring fresh perspectives to complex problems.

MP Daniel Zeichner and Trusted Adult Scheme facilitators and participants posing with 'ARU in the Community' graffiti artwork by William 'Kilo' Pengelly
Trusted Adult Scheme (TAS)

TAS supports children and young people living in Cambridgeshire by providing opportunities for activity and engagement with trusted adults in a safe space.
